Making the Most of a Layover in Vienna
#

Vienna, the capital of Austria , is known for its imperial palaces, historic sites, and lively cultural scene. The city is compact enough that you can visit several key attractions even during a short layover. The efficient public transport system, including trams, buses, and the U-Bahn, makes it easy to navigate. Depending on your available time, you can opt for a quick tour or a more in-depth experience.

A practical tip: Always check the local time and your flight schedule to ensure you have enough time to explore and return to the airport without stress.

What You Can See in 4-8 Hours
#

vienna-layover-tours

With a layover of 4 to 8 hours, you can comfortably visit several key attractions in Vienna. Start with a visit to Schönbrunn Palace, where the stunning gardens offer a perfect backdrop for a leisurely stroll. Afterward, head to the historic center, where you can see St. Stephen’s Cathedral and the Hofburg Palace.

When planning your layover, it’s essential to consider travel logistics. The airport is approximately 18 kilometers from the city center, and the City Airport Train (CAT) provides a quick connection, taking about 16 minutes. Taxis and shuttle services are also available, but they may take longer due to traffic.
